Electrical Wiring and Connection Issues

One of the most common problems encountered during heated car seat installation is electrical wiring and connection issues. Incorrect wiring or loose connections can lead to malfunctioning heated seats, reduced performance, or even safety hazards. To avoid these issues, ensure that you follow the manufacturer’s wiring diagrams and use high-quality electrical connectors.

  • Use a multimeter to verify the electrical connections and ensure that they meet the required specifications.
  • Label and organize your wiring to prevent confusion and reduce the risk of incorrect connections.

Seat Frame and Mounting Challenges

Another common challenge when installing heated car seats is dealing with seat frame and mounting issues. Heated seats often require additional support and mounting hardware to ensure proper installation and secure the seats in place. Be prepared to drill additional holes or use specialized mounting brackets to accommodate your vehicle’s seat frame.

  • Consult your vehicle’s repair manual or online resources to determine the correct mounting points and hardware requirements.
  • Use a level to ensure that your heated seats are properly aligned and secured to the seat frame.

How do I Choose the Right Heated Car Seat Kit for My Vehicle?

To choose the right heated car seat kit, you’ll need to identify your vehicle’s make and model, and select a kit that matches your seat type (e.g., bucket, bench, or captain’s chair). Consider factors like power consumption, heat settings, and installation complexity. Research online reviews, consult with experts, or consult your vehicle’s manual to ensure compatibility and optimal performance.

Can I Install Heated Car Seats on My Classic or Vintage Vehicle?

While it’s technically possible to install heated car seats on a classic or vintage vehicle, it may require additional modifications and expertise. You’ll need to ensure that your vehicle’s electrical system can support the heating system, and that any modifications won’t compromise the vehicle’s original design or safety features. Consult with a professional or a classic car expert to determine the feasibility and best approach for your specific vehicle.
